We were caught by surprise. After exceptional performance and rewards- the news came in today about a layoff. Extremely ruthless of IBM to keep this a secret and do this to families in COVID times. If this was preplanned and not related to COVID- wish they could have timed it better for their employees. Most of the companies are on hiring freeze. Would have appreciated a headsup. Additionally, There was no sense to the layoff - the best of performers are also impacted instead of juggling them in other departments the management decided to reward the best performers on one hand and lay them off on the other. Why would anyone want to stay with such a fickle minded management? Advice to other eployees: save yourself and your families.
